The Warm Audio WA-44 Studio Ribbon Microphone is a faithful recreation of one of the most legendary broadcast ribbon microphones ever made. Revered since the 1930s for its rich, warm tone and unmistakable presence, the original 44 became a studio and broadcast staple. Now, Warm Audio has brought this iconic sound back with the WA-44, delivering vintage authenticity and modern reliability. At its core, the WA-44 uses a finely engineered 2.5-micron aluminum ribbon, a robust neodymium magnet, and a custom CineMag USA transformer to reproduce the smooth top end, lush midrange, and bold proximity effect that made the original so famous. With its tight figure-8 polar pattern, the WA-44 captures your source with precision while rejecting off-axis noise for cleaner, more focused recordings. Capable of handling up to 140dB SPL with a broad 20Hz–20kHz frequency response, the WA-44 is equally at home recording delicate acoustic instruments, full drum kits, horns, strings, piano, and lead vocals. Its ability to tame harshness and deliver a natural, velvety tone makes it an invaluable tool for engineers and artists seeking a timeless ribbon mic character.Bundled with a premium Gotham Star-Quad XLR cable and a protective case, the WA-44 is ready for professional use right out of the box. The new WA-87 R2 uses top-quality components like a NOS Fairchild transistor and high-bandwidth polystyrene and film capacitors from Wima. The WA-87 R2 uses a custom-wound Cinemag USA output transformer like the original WA-87 did, with the new version providing a slightly increased output level and improved frequency response. We also employed the same capsule the WA-87 uses, which was designed to the exact specifications of the ones found in the vintage mics. The WA-87 R2 also features three polar patterns (cardioid, omni and figure 8) so you're covered for a wide variety of applications, and an 80Hz high pass filter reduces low-frequency rumble if needed. The switchable -10dB pad comes in handy when you want to record extremely loud sources and not overload the internal electronics. The WA-87 R2 works brilliantly on vocals, drum overheads, guitars, piano, auxiliary percussion, brass, strings and more.
